
For car , it is best to use fully synthetic engine oil, which is much better than semi-synthetic engine oil. The differences between fully synthetic and semi-synthetic engine oils are as follows: Different base oils: Semi-synthetic engine oil uses Group III base oil, while fully synthetic engine oil is a mixture of Group III, IV, and V base oils. Fully synthetic engine oil is one grade higher in base oil selection than semi-synthetic engine oil. Different replacement intervals: Semi-synthetic engine oil should be replaced every six months or 7,500 kilometers, while fully synthetic engine oil should be replaced every year or 10,000 kilometers. For example, the fully synthetic engine oil from CEPSA can be replaced every 18 months or 15,000 kilometers. Different applicable temperatures: Fully synthetic engine oil has a wider range of applicable temperatures. Under the same working conditions, fully synthetic oil can protect the engine with lower viscosity, while semi-synthetic engine oil has relatively higher usage requirements.

I'm fascinated by automotive technology, and new engine oils like full synthetic or semi-synthetic low-viscosity oils are amazing. They improve fuel efficiency, for example, 5W-30 maintains stable performance across various temperatures. The viscosity numbers are a bit more profound: 5W indicates the low-temperature flow value, while 30 represents high-temperature performance. When choosing, consider your vehicle model—high-performance engines are better suited for synthetic oils, which optimize cold-start protection.
